Tải bản đầy đủ (.ppt) (21 trang)

T 12

Bạn đang xem bản rút gọn của tài liệu. Xem và tải ngay bản đầy đủ của tài liệu tại đây (2.5 MB, 21 trang )

<span class='text_page_counter'>(1)</span><div class='page_container' data-page=1></div>
<span class='text_page_counter'>(2)</span><div class='page_container' data-page=2></div>
<span class='text_page_counter'>(3)</span><div class='page_container' data-page=3>

1. Bài tốn quản lí



<b>Theo em để quản </b>
<b>lí thơng tin về </b>


<b>điểm của học sinh </b>
<b>trong một lớp em </b>
<b>nên lập danh sách </b>
<b>chứa các cột nào?</b>


<b>Để quản lý học sinh trong nhà trường, người ta thường lập các </b>
<b>biểu bảng gồm các cột, hàng để chứa các thông tin cần quản lý.</b>


</div>
<span class='text_page_counter'>(4)</span><div class='page_container' data-page=4>

<b>Stt</b> <b>Họ tên</b> <b>Ngày Sinh</b> <b><sub>Tính </sub> Giới </b> <b>Đồn <sub>Viên</sub></b> <b>Điểm <sub>Lý</sub></b> <b>Điểm <sub>Hóa</sub></b> <b>Điểm <sub>Tin</sub></b>


1 Nguyễn An 12/8/1991 Nam C 7,8 8,0 5,0
2 Trần Văn Giang 21/3/1990 Nam K 6,0 9,0 9,0
3 Lê Minh Châu 3/5/1991 Nữ C 7,0 8,0 9,5
4 Doãn Thu Cúc 14/2/1990 Nữ K 7,5 8,5 8,0


</div>
<span class='text_page_counter'>(5)</span><div class='page_container' data-page=5>

<b>CHÚ Ý</b>



<sub>Hồ sơ quản lí học sinh của nhà trường là tập hợp các </sub>



hồ sơ lớp.



<sub>Trong quá trình quản lí, hồ sơ có thể có những bổ sung, </sub>



thay đổi hay nhầm lẫn đòi hỏi phải sửa đổi lại.




<sub>Việc tạo lập hồ sơ không chỉ dùng để lưu trữ mà chủ </sub>



</div>
<span class='text_page_counter'>(6)</span><div class='page_container' data-page=6>

<b>Stt</b> <b>Họ tên</b> <b>Ngày Sinh</b> <b><sub>Tính </sub> Giới </b> <b>Đồn <sub>Viên</sub></b> <b>Điểm <sub>Lý</sub></b> <b>Điểm <sub>Hóa</sub></b> <b>Thẻ <sub>BH</sub></b>


1 Nguyễn An 12/8/1991 Nam C 7,8 8,0 5,0
2 Trần Văn Giang 21/3/1990 Nam K 6,0 9,0 9,0
3 Lê Minh Châu 3/5/1991 Nữ C 7,0 8,0 9,5
4 Doãn Thu Cúc 14/2/1990 Nữ K 7,5 8,5 8,0


<b>a. Tạo lập hồ sơ về các đối tượng cần quản lí</b>
<b> </b>


<sub>Xác định chủ thể cần quản lí</sub>


<sub>Xác định cấu trúc hồ sơ</sub>



</div>
<span class='text_page_counter'>(7)</span><div class='page_container' data-page=7>

<b>Stt</b> <b>Họ tên</b> <b>Ngày Sinh</b> <b><sub>Tính </sub> Giới </b> <b>Đồn <sub>Viên</sub></b> <b>Điểm <sub>Lý</sub></b> <b>Điểm <sub>Hóa</sub></b> <b>Điểm <sub>Tin</sub></b>


1 Nguyễn An 12/8/1991 Nam C 7,8 8,0 5,0
2 Trần Văn Giang 21/3/1990 Nam C 6,0 9,0 9,0
3 Doãn Thu Cúc 14/2/1990 Nữ C 7,5 8,5 8,0


4 Nguyễn Gia lâm 11/8/1991 Nam C 6,6 6,5 8,4


5


<b>b. Cập nhật hồ sơ (thêm, xóa, sửa hồ sơ)</b>



<sub>Thông tin lưu trữ trong hồ sơ cần được cập </sub>




</div>
<span class='text_page_counter'>(8)</span><div class='page_container' data-page=8>

<b>c. Khai thác hồ sơ</b>



<b><sub> Sắp xếp</sub></b>


<b><sub> Tìm kiếm</sub></b>


<b><sub> Thống kê</sub></b>



<b><sub> Lập báo cáo: là việc sử dụng các kết quả tìm kiếm, </sub></b>



<b>thống kê, sắp xếp các bộ hồ sơ để in ra giấy</b>



<b>Stt</b> <b>Họ tên</b> <b>Ngày Sinh</b> <b><sub>Tính </sub> Giới </b> <b>Đồn <sub>Viên</sub></b> <b>Điểm <sub>Lý</sub></b> <b>Điểm <sub>Hóa</sub></b> <b>Điểm <sub>Tin</sub></b>


</div>
<span class='text_page_counter'>(9)</span><div class='page_container' data-page=9>

<b>Câu 1: Các cơng việc thường gặp khi quản lí thơng </b>


<b>tin của một đối tượng nào đó?</b>



<b>Câu 2: Lập bảng thứ 1 trên giấy gồm hai cột, cột 1 </b>


<b>đặt tên là Tên môn học để liệt kê tất cả các môn học </b>


<b>mà em đang học, cột 2 đặt tên Mã môn học, dùng ký </b>


<b>hiệu 1,2,3.... để đặt tên cho từng môn học. Đặt tên </b>


<b>cho bảng Môn học.</b>



<b>Câu 3: Lập bảng thứ 2, gồm các cột sau:Mã học </b>



</div>
<span class='text_page_counter'>(10)</span><div class='page_container' data-page=10></div>
<span class='text_page_counter'>(11)</span><div class='page_container' data-page=11>

<b>3. Hệ cơ sở dữ liệu</b>



<i><b>a. </b></i><b>Khái niệm cơ sở dữ liệu và hệ quản trị cơ sở dữ liệu</b>:
Dữ liệu lưu trên máy


có ưu điểm gì so với
một dữ liệu lưu trên



giấy?


<b>Stt</b> <b>Họ tên</b> <b>Ngày Sinh</b> <b><sub>Tính </sub> Giới </b> <b>Đồn <sub>Viên</sub></b> <b>Điểm <sub>Lý</sub></b> <b>Điểm <sub>Hóa</sub></b> <b>Điểm <sub>Tin</sub></b>


</div>
<span class='text_page_counter'>(12)</span><div class='page_container' data-page=12>

<b>3. Hệ cơ sở dữ liệu</b>



<i><b>a. </b></i><b>Khái niệm cơ sở dữ liệu và hệ quản trị cơ sở dữ liệu</b>:


<b><sub>Hệ quản trị CSDL:</sub></b>


Là <b>phần mềm</b> cung cấp một môi trường thuận lợi và hiệu quả để <b>tạo lập, </b>
<b>lưu trữ và tìm kiếm thơng tin của CSDL</b> được gọi là hệ quản trị CSDL
(hệ QTCSDL-<b>D</b>ata<b>B</b>ase <b>M</b>anegement <b>S</b>ystem)


<b><sub> Một cơ sở dữ liệu</sub></b><sub> (Database):</sub>


Là <b>tập hợp các dữ liệu có liên quan với nhau</b>, chứa thơng tin của
một đối tượng nào đó (như một trường học, một bệnh viện, một


ngân hàng, một nhà máy...), <b>được lưu trữ trên các thíêt bị nhớ </b>để
đáp ứng <b>nhu cầu khai thác thông tin</b> của nhiều người sử dụng với
nhiều mục đích khác nhau.


</div>
<span class='text_page_counter'>(13)</span><div class='page_container' data-page=13>

<b>3. Hệ cơ sở dữ liệu</b>



<i><b>a. </b></i><b>Khái niệm cơ sở dữ liệu và hệ quản trị cơ sở dữ liệu</b>:


<i>Chú ý:</i>

Người ta thường dùng thuật ngữ hệ cơ sở dữ liệu để chỉ


một CSDL và HQTCSDL quản trị và khai thác CSDL đó.




Như vậy để lưu trữ và khai thác thơng
tin bằng máy tính cần phải có :


<sub> CSDL</sub>


<sub> Hệ QTCSDL</sub>


<sub> Các thiết bị vật lý (máy tính, đĩa cứng, </sub>


</div>
<span class='text_page_counter'>(14)</span><div class='page_container' data-page=14>

<b>3. Hệ cơ sở dữ liệu</b>



<i><b>Các thành phần của hệ CSDL</b></i>


CSDL



</div>
<span class='text_page_counter'>(15)</span><div class='page_container' data-page=15>

<b>3. Hệ cơ sở dữ liệu</b>



<b>b. Các mức thể hiện của CSDL:</b>



<b>DỮ LIỆU</b>


<b>Mức vật lí của CSDL </b>


<sub> Mức vật lí: CSDL vật lí là tập hợp </sub>



các tệp dữ liệu tồn tại trên các thiết bị


nhớ.



<i>Ví dụ</i>

: CSDL vật lí của CSDL lớp




</div>
<span class='text_page_counter'>(16)</span><div class='page_container' data-page=16>

<b>3. Hệ cơ sở dữ liệu</b>



<sub> Mức khái niệm: Nhóm người quản trị </sub>


hệ CSDL hoặc phát triển các ứng dụng họ
cần phải biết: Những dữ liệu nào được
lưu trữ trong hệ CSDl? Giữa các dữ liệu
có các mối quan hệ nào?


<i>Ví dụ</i>: một lớp học sinh, mỗi học sinh có
một số thơng tin :họ tên,ngày sinh,giới
tính….tạo thành một bảng, mỗi cột là một
thuộc tính, mỗi hàng tương ứng với thông
tin về một học sinh


<b>b. Các mức thể hiện của CSDL:</b>



</div>
<span class='text_page_counter'>(17)</span><div class='page_container' data-page=17>

<b>3. Hệ cơ sở dữ liệu</b>



<b>b. Các mức thể hiện của CSDL:</b>



<sub> Mức khung nhìn: Khi khai thác cơ sở dữ liệu một người dùng </sub>


khơng quan tâm đến tồn bộ thong tin trong csdl mà chỉ cần một
phần thong tin nào đó phù hợp với nghiệp vụ hay mục đích sử
dụng của mình


<i><sub>Ví dụ:</sub></i><sub> nếu bỏ bớt một vài cột của CSDL khái niệm lớp phần </sub>



</div>
<span class='text_page_counter'>(18)</span><div class='page_container' data-page=18>

<b>3. Hệ cơ sở dữ liệu</b>



<b>b. Các mức thể hiện của CSDL:</b>



<i><b>Giao diện dành cho GVCN</b></i>


<i><b>Giao diện dành cho GV môn Tin học</b></i>


</div>
<span class='text_page_counter'>(19)</span><div class='page_container' data-page=19>

<b>3. Hệ cơ sở dữ liệu</b>



</div>
<span class='text_page_counter'>(20)</span><div class='page_container' data-page=20>

<b>Câu 1: Phân biệt CSDL với hệ QTCSDL </b>



<b>Câu 2: Giả sử phải xây dựng một CSDL để quản lý </b>


mượn, trả sách ở thư viện, theo em cần phải lưu trữ


những thơng tin gì? Hãy cho biết những việc phải làm


để đáp ứng nhu cầu quản lí của người thủ thư.



</div>
<span class='text_page_counter'>(21)</span><div class='page_container' data-page=21></div>

<!--links-->

Tài liệu bạn tìm kiếm đã sẵn sàng tải về

Tải bản đầy đủ ngay
×